BERGER LAHR D - 77901 Lahr Conceptual drawing of WGL30 / 40 with O2 trim The key points: • Sliding-two-stage or modulating load control when firing on gas, two-stage load control when firing on oil • W-FM25 O2 for O2 trim • The separately motorised oil pump is decoupled while the burner is firing on gas • Fuel changeover via selection switch or field bus module • Non-interchangeable plugs ensure the correct electrical connection of all components • Safety is ensured by the reciprocal monitoring of two microprocessors • Fully electronic control and diagnosis • Flame monitoring via KLC/FLW infrared...

Class D gas oil per BS 2869 / IS 251 Class A2 gas oil per BS 2869 / IS 251 10 % biodiesel blends (B10) The suitability of fuels of differing quality must be confirmed in advance with Weishaupt. Weishaupt WGL30 and WGL40 burners with W-FM 25 combustion manager are suitable for intermittent firing on: - LTHW boilers - Group II and III steam boilers - Certain process applications - Ambient temperature - Maximum 80 % relative humidity, no condensation - The combustion air must be free of aggressive substances (halogens, chlorides, fluorides etc.) and impurities (dust, debris, vapours, etc.) - Adequate...

The burner capacity graphs are certified in accordance with EN 676 and EN 267. The stated ratings are based on an air temperature of 20 °C and an installation at sea level. For installations at higher altitudes, a reduction in capacity of 1 % per 100 m above sea level should be taken into account. The combustion chamber pressure of the heat generator must be added to the flow pressure determined from the chart when sizing the gas valve train. Minimum flow pressure 15 mbar. Minimum 125 kW full-load firing rate for two-stage operation The LHV is referenced to 0 °C and 1013 mbar atmospheric. * The...
